process of assigning tasks to workers to reach the desired capacity is called line balancing. group of answer choices false true

Answers

Answer 1

The given statement" The process of assigning tasks to workers to reach the desired capacity is indeed called line balancing, is true because it is an important concept in production and operations management.

Line balancing is an important concept in production and operations management, as it focuses on the efficient distribution of tasks among workers or machines in a production line.

The main objective of line balancing is to minimize idle time and maximize overall productivity, ensuring that each worker or machine operates at an optimal level. By achieving a well-balanced line, organizations can reduce production costs, improve lead times, and enhance product quality, ultimately leading to increased customer satisfaction and business success.

_____are the minimum quantity required in a period based on gross requirements minus the sum of scheduled receipts and available inventory at the end of the last period.

Answers

The answer is "Planned order releases".

Planned order releases are the minimum quantity required in a period based on gross requirements minus the sum of scheduled receipts and available inventory at the end of the last period.

Planned order releases help in determining when and how much to order. It is a key component of Material Requirements Planning (MRP) system.

MRP helps in managing inventory, production scheduling and tracking, and supply chain management. The planned order releases help in ensuring that the right amount of raw materials or components are available at the right time for the production process.

By having a clear understanding of planned order releases, businesses can optimize their production process, minimize inventory costs, and ensure that they can meet customer demands in a timely manner.

____ diversification is when a firm enters a different business that has little horizontal interaction with other business of a firm
A) Horizontal
B) Synergistic
C) Unrelated
D) Related

Answers

Diversification refers to a firm entering a different business that has limited horizontal interaction with its existing businesses.

C) Unrelated diversification is the correct answer. Unrelated diversification occurs when a company expands into a new business that has little or no strategic similarity or operational connection to its current business activities.

The new business operates independently and does not rely on synergies or shared resources with the existing businesses of the firm. This type of diversification allows a company to explore new markets, reduce risk by not relying solely on one industry, and potentially benefit from the growth opportunities of different sectors.

Unrelated diversification can provide a hedge against industry-specific risks but also presents challenges in terms of managing multiple unrelated businesses and achieving economies of scale.

why should project managers always initiate a project (phase one) before making a plan (phase two)? quizerra

Answers

As establishing the project's scope, cost, and timeliness is necessary to setting up a budget, a timetable, and assigning roles and duties, it is best practice for project managers to start a project (phase one) before formulating a plan (phase two).

What do you call it when needs are added to the project scope but the budget or schedule remain the same?

Scope creep is one of the most common project management issues. When new project requirements are added by project clients or other stakeholders after project execution has started, this is known as scope creep. Often, these modifications are not adequately evaluated.

Why is it important to have a project scope and a scope management plan?

What is and is not included in the project is defined by the project scope, which also governs what is permitted and what must be dropped throughout execution. In order to prevent modifications during the course of the project, control factors are developed through the scope management process.

a differentiation strategy is best described as when a company​ ________.

Answers

A differentiation strategy is best described as when a company creates a unique and distinctive product or service that sets it apart from the competition.

It is a way of standing out in a crowded market and establishing a competitive advantage over rivals. By differentiating themselves, companies can offer something that customers cannot find anywhere else, creating a strong brand identity and loyal customer base. There are many ways to implement a differentiation strategy. One way is to focus on product features or design. This might involve incorporating new materials, technologies, or functionalities that other products on the market do not have.

Another way is to emphasize service quality, providing exceptional customer service, support, or after-sales service that exceeds customer expectations. Yet another way is to create a unique brand identity through marketing and advertising, building a distinct brand personality and image that resonates with customers. A successful differentiation strategy requires careful market research and analysis, as well as a deep understanding of customer needs and preferences. Companies must also have the resources and capabilities to deliver on their promises, whether through product development, service delivery, or marketing and advertising. Ultimately, a differentiation strategy can be a powerful way for companies to create a sustainable competitive advantage and achieve long-term success in their respective markets.
